The drastic decrease in three of the cyclins likely occurs in A. Mitosis. During mitosis, cyclins that are involved in promoting progression through earlier phases of the cell cycle are often degraded, leading to a reduction in their levels. This ensures that the cell properly transitions through the phases of division and resets for the next cycle.
